034. Mimmi Kotka | Lavaredo Ultra Trail 2022 win, dealing with RED-S, building a sustainable career and future

Mimmi Kotka is a professional trail and ultra runner from Sweden sponsored by La Sportiva.

Last weekend she won Lavaredo Ultra Trail, a 120km - 6000m of elevation race in the Italian Dolomites and one of the most famous and iconic ultra trail races in the world.

We talk about her race strategy, the difficulties that she handled, especially in the last section of race, and what this win meant to her.

We also talk about how her professional running career started, her most competitive years and best performances in the sport, her struggles with RED-S and how she dealt with it, finally coming back to train and race like she knows she can.
